Understanding the 24 bit integer limit is essential for anyone working with digital systems, audio processing, or legacy hardware. At its core, this constraint dictates that a specific data channel can only represent 16,777,216 distinct values, a boundary that fundamentally shapes how information is captured and stored. This limitation arises directly from the binary nature of computing, where the number of possible combinations is determined by raising two to the power of the bit depth.
Defining 24-Bit Resolution
A 24-bit integer utilizes exactly 24 binary digits to encode a single piece of information. Because each digit can be either a zero or a one, the total number of unique combinations available is calculated as 2 to the power of 24. This results in a theoretical maximum value of 16,777,215, creating a specific ceiling that software and hardware must respect. This resolution is widely favored because it offers a significant balance between dynamic range and file size, making it a standard in specific professional domains.
Applications in Audio Engineering
One of the most prominent uses of this standard is in digital audio recording and production. During the CD era and the rise of digital workstations, 24 bit integer became the de facto standard for studio recording. The high resolution provided enough numerical space to capture the full dynamic range of acoustic instruments with minimal noise floor. This ensured that the quietest whispers and the loudest peaks could be transcribed with exceptional fidelity, preserving the emotional impact of the performance for listeners.
Dynamic Range and Headroom
The primary advantage of adopting this standard lies in the immense dynamic range it affords an engineer. With 24 available levels, the signal-to-noise ratio is exceptionally high, allowing for the preservation of subtle details in quiet passages. Furthermore, it provides substantial headroom during the recording phase, protecting against digital clipping. This safety margin means that transient sounds like drum hits or plucked strings can be captured accurately without distortion, ensuring the integrity of the source material.
Constraints and Practical Considerations
Despite its advantages, the 24 bit integer limit presents specific challenges that professionals must navigate. When processing audio, mathematical operations can generate numbers that exceed the original 24-bit container. To prevent data loss in these scenarios, modern software often utilizes a higher internal precision, such as 32-bit floating point, before truncating the final result back to 24 bits. Failure to manage this process correctly can result in quantization errors, manifesting as a gritty or distorted sound.
Color Depth and Digital Imaging
Beyond audio, the 24 bit integer limit is a foundational concept in digital graphics, specifically regarding color representation. In the RGB color model, this standard allocates 8 bits for red, 8 bits for green, and 8 bits for blue. The combination of these three channels allows for the reproduction of 16.7 million different colors, which the human eye generally perceives as smooth gradients. This "True Color" specification is the default for most monitors and image files, defining the visual fidelity of the modern web.